Complexity Involved In Printed Circuit Board Design
Often abbreviated as pcb design bureau, a printed circuit board is used for mechanical support and to connect the electronic components with the use of tracks or signal traces. These have been etched from copper sheets and then laminated onto a non-conductive substance. It is called by several other names such as etched wiring board and printed wiring board.
There are certain alternatives to printed circuit board fabrication; point to point connection and wire wrap are the most commonly used alternatives to a PCB. They are the cheaper, faster and more reliable options when a high volume production is in process, owing to the process of automation available. The design and production standards are set by IPC organization. Almost all the electronic goods deploy the use of printed circuit board design.
A printed circuit board manufacturer would ideally use four materials of laminates, copper clad laminates, resin impregnated B-stage cloth and copper foil. If there is a requirement of any special material, then the printed circuit board fabrication process uses a different material as required for the desired output.
The manufacturing process in itself is quite complex. It requires a complex series of operations for the whole process. After the file of specifications is received, the order is worked upon. A layer of copper is applied over the entire circuit board on either one side or both sides. This makes the board a blank printed one. Now, the unwanted areas are removed through the process of photo engraving by a subtractive process.
In the next step, the circuit board is given a protective layering of lamination. The boards should have the ability to connect to each other and the small holes are drilled by the use of drilling machine so that they can be fixed flex PCB. The process is called VIAS.
